Question 1

The following frequency distribution shows the ACT scores of a sample of students:

 

Score

Frequency

14 - 18

  2

19 - 23

  5

24 - 28

12

29 - 33

  1


For the above data, compute the following.
 

a.The mean
b.The standard deviation

The following frequency distribution shows the GMAT scores of a sample of MBA students.

 

GMAT Score

Frequency

300 up to 400

1

400 up to 500

5

500 up to 600

9

600 up to 700

3

700 up to 800

2


For the above data, compute the mean GMAT score.

The first successful kidney transplant was performed in 1954 and occurred in Boston. A kidney from an identical twin was transplanted into his dying brother's body and was not rejected because it did not appear foreign to his body.

For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.
